Check which Kubernetes tooling the project uses:
helm/ or Chart.yaml → Helm chartskustomize/ or kustomization.yaml → Kustomizek8s/ or kubernetes/ with *.yaml → Raw manifestsskaffold.yaml → Skaffold for local devargocd/ or Application resources → ArgoCD GitOpsflux-system/ or Kustomization CRD → Flux GitOpsUse the context7 MCP server to look up Kubernetes API versions and syntax.
| Workload Type | Use When |
|---|---|
| Deployment | Stateless apps, web servers, APIs |
| StatefulSet | Databases, stateful apps needing stable identity |
| DaemonSet | Node-level agents (logging, monitoring) |
| Job | One-time tasks, batch processing |
| CronJob | Scheduled recurring tasks |
resources:
requests: # Scheduler uses for placement
memory: "256Mi"
cpu: "100m"
limits: # Kubelet enforces these
memory: "512Mi"
cpu: "500m"
Rules:
| Class | Condition | Eviction Priority |
|---|---|---|
| Guaranteed | requests == limits (all containers) | Last to evict |
| Burstable | requests < limits | Medium |
| BestEffort | No requests or limits | First to evict |
Rule: Production workloads should be Guaranteed or Burstable, never BestEffort.

apiVersion: policy/v1
kind: PodDisruptionBudget
metadata:
name: api-pdb
spec:
minAvailable: 2 # OR maxUnavailable: 1
selector:
matchLabels:
app: api
Rule: Always create PDB for production workloads to ensure availability during node drains.
affinity:
podAntiAffinity:
preferredDuringSchedulingIgnoredDuringExecution:
- weight: 100
podAffinityTerm:
labelSelector:
matchLabels:
app: api
topologyKey: kubernetes.io/hostname
Rule: Spread replicas across nodes/zones for high availability.

| Scaling Type | Use When | Tool |
|---|---|---|
| CPU-based | General compute workloads | HPA |
| Memory-based | Memory-intensive apps | HPA |
| Custom metrics | Queue depth, request rate | HPA + Prometheus Adapter |
| Event-driven | Message queues, scheduled jobs | KEDA |
| Vertical | Right-sizing requests/limits | VPA |

securityContext:
runAsNonRoot: true
runAsUser: 1000
runAsGroup: 1000
fsGroup: 1000
seccompProfile:
type: RuntimeDefault
containers:
- name: app
securityContext:
allowPrivilegeEscalation: false
readOnlyRootFilesystem: true
capabilities:
drop:
- ALL
Rule: Always run as non-root with minimal capabilities in production.

|---|---|
Use latest image tag | Pin specific versions or SHA |
| Skip resource requests | Always set requests for scheduling |
| Single replica in production | Minimum 2 replicas with PDB |
| Run as root | Use non-root user with minimal caps |
| Missing readiness probe | Configure probes for graceful traffic |
kubectl apply in production | GitOps with ArgoCD/Flux |
| Hardcode values in manifests | Use Helm values or Kustomize overlays |
| Ignore pod eviction | Set PDB to maintain availability |
